針對jdbc中的事務管理,在springdao中同樣有著事務管理模式。
其分兩種:
程式設計式事務管理
宣告式事務管理
前者不多用,後者方便故多用,本文就後者進行描述。
proxy-target-class="true" />
<2>在需要新增事務管理的地方新增@transactional
@service
public class bankservice ,
isolation=isolation.serializable,propagation=propagation.required)
public void transfer(bankaccount from,bankaccount to,double money) throws bankaccountexception{
望能對小夥伴對事務管理理解 有所幫助!
Spring中的宣告式事務
目錄 什麼是宣告式事務 不加事務 使用宣告式事務解決問題 transactional spring在不同的事務管理api之上定義了乙個抽象層,使得開發人員不必了解底層的事務管理api就可以使用spring的事務管理機制。spring支援程式設計式事務管理和宣告式的事務管理。程式設計式事務管理 宣告式...
宣告式事務
宣告式事務編輯以方法為單位,進行事物控制 丟擲異常,事物回滾。最小的執行單位為方法。決定執行成敗是通過是否丟擲異常來判斷的,丟擲異常即執行失敗 宣告式事務 declarative transaction management 是spring提供的對程式事務管理的方式之一。spring的宣告式事務顧名...
防衛式宣告
標準格式 在標頭檔案中寫 ifndef define endif 通過閱讀 geekband c 學習筆記 防衛式宣告的背後 發現編譯器對頭檔案進行了以下預處理 編譯器還會做很多其他事情,但是從第四條可以看出,會將標頭檔案中寫的 直接複製進檔案。那麼可以想象,如果有多份標頭檔案均不進行防衛式宣告,均...